发表评论取消回复
相关阅读
相关 如何解决Java项目中内存溢出问题
在Java项目中遇到内存溢出问题,通常可以通过以下几个步骤进行排查和解决: 1. **代码审查**: - 检查是否有无限循环或者递归调用没有正确的边界条件。 -
相关 初级程序员:如何解决Java内存溢出问题?
Java内存溢出(Memory OutOfBounds,简称OOM)通常发生在以下情况: 1. 内存分配不足:比如创建了大量的对象,但系统的总可用内存不足以存储这些对象。
相关 如何解决Java中的内存溢出问题案例
在Java中,内存溢出主要发生在以下几个方面: 1. 对象过大:如果一个对象的大小超过了可用的堆空间,就会导致内存溢出。例如,如果你创建了一个非常大的字符串,可能会超出Jav
相关 解决Java中的内存溢出问题
在Java中,内存溢出通常发生在以下几种情况: 1. 对象无限递归:如果你的代码创建了一个无限递归的对象,那么垃圾回收机制将无法处理,从而导致内存溢出。 2. 大数组未释放
相关 理解并解决Java内存溢出问题的实践案例
Java内存溢出问题通常发生在系统资源(如堆内存)不足,程序无法正确释放已占用的内存时。下面是一个具体的实践案例: 案例名称:银行账户管理系统内存溢出 1. **场景描述*
相关 常见Java内存溢出问题及解决案例
内存溢出(Memory Leak)是Java编程中常见的问题,它会导致程序占用的内存持续增加,最终可能引发系统资源耗尽。以下是一些常见的内存泄漏问题以及解决方案: 1. 未关
相关 实战案例:如何在Java中避免内存溢出
内存溢出(Memory Overflow)通常发生在程序无法有效管理其占用的内存资源时。以下是在Java中避免内存溢出的一些策略: 1. **适当的数据结构选择**:
相关 理解并解决Java中的内存溢出问题
在Java中,内存溢出(Memory Overflow)通常是指程序申请的内存超过了系统的物理限制。 以下是一些解决Java内存溢出问题的方法: 1. **理解内存分配原理
相关 如何解决Java应用中的内存溢出问题
在Java应用程序中,如果处理的数据量过大或者程序设计存在缺陷,就可能会出现内存溢出的问题。以下是一些解决办法: 1. **合理使用对象**:每个对象占用一定的内存,尽量减少
相关 如何解决在高性能应用中的Java内存溢出问题
在高性能应用中,Java内存溢出通常是由于以下几个原因导致的: 1. 对象泄露:当对象不再使用时,没有正确地调用`finalize()`方法或垃圾回收机制将其回收。 2.
还没有评论,来说两句吧...